Important 16th Century Renaissance Florentine Drop Front Desk Cabinet
About the Item
An Italian Florentine Renaissance Carved Burl Walnut Fall-Front Writing Cabinet, Circa 1560, 16th century
From the Davanzatti Palace Museum in Florence
Height: 59 inches x 36 inches wide x 17-1/2 inches deep
(149.9 x 91.4 x 44.5 cm)
From the renaissance period in Northern Tuscan Florentine Italy; this very important and well documented drop front desk cabinet in carved burl walnut and has adorned the palaces of Florence for almost 500 years. This particular cabinet is beautifully proportioned at roughly 5 x 3 feet; hence will fit in almost any space and make it the focal point in any room.
PROVENANCE:
Collection of Professore Elia Volpi; The top collector, antiquarian, museum consultant and author of several books on the most important furniture of Europe.
The American Art Association, New York, Art Treasures and Antiquities Formerly Contained in The Famous Davanzati Palace, November 22, 1916, lot 311;
Collection of David Abbate;
CRN Auctions, Cambridge, Massachusetts, A Passion for the Renaissance, the estate of David Abbate, May 31, 2014, lot 130;
Acquired from the above by current owner. The collection of Frederick H. Schrader. Thence to Avantiques.
LITERATURE:
The American Art Association, Illustrated Catalogue of Art Treasures and Antiquities Formerly Contained in The Famous Davanzati Palace, New York, 1916, p. 154-155, no. 311. (Photos attatched)
H. Donaldson Eberlein and R. Wearne Ramsdell, The Practical Book of Italian, Spanish, and Portuguese Furniture, Philadelphia & London, 1927, plate 16, fig. B. (Photos attached)
Property from the Collection of Frederick H. Schrader
Condition Report: Overall presents well. Wear to velvet details of lock and latches. Wear to proper right front edge where latch sits. Marks of professional restoration to burlwood front. Lock mechanisms to interior cabinets no longer extant. Splits, nicks, and wormholes scattered throughout, as expected with age and material.

At the beginning of the reign of Henri II (1547-1559) the furniture’s ornamentation evolves. The few medieval motifs that were still used are eventually relinquished. Furniture becomes more sober showcasing moulded panels and perfect architecture. Cabinet-makers use ornaments such as curved fluted or plain columns, feather quills, roses or winged putti heads. High-relief carving becomes more scarce and compositions lighter. To that end cabinet-makers draw inspiration from Fontainebleau motifs filtering them and adapting them to French taste.
During this period cabinet-makers turn into a kind of architects. Indeed the architectural balance of furniture is the centre of their concerns. The study of Antic formulas is then a necessity. From this care given to proportions appear refined cabinets with pure lines.
This style is characteristic of the reign of Henri II and disappears soon after under the regency of Catherine de Medici (1560-1574) when an abundance of high and low-relief ornaments comes back on furnitures.
